Output 2577500d303d9f12a5823a3d59fece31d7ffc8994883e6be63099d98a7656023:0

value
172293762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845e837e1268a72bc1422d746f1b16e9d128f02c OP_EQUAL
address
3DkvLngLfFKjYQ6Rvf375dVA2roMabPkAj
transaction
2577500d303d9f12a5823a3d59fece31d7ffc8994883e6be63099d98a7656023
spent
true